  200 Double CT Blue Tungsten to Daylight 2,800K to 10,000K. 16.20
  201 Full CT Blue Tungsten to Photographic Daylight 3,200K to 5,700K. 36.00
  202 Half CT Blue Converts tungsten to daylight - 3200K to 4300K. 55.00
  203 1/4 CT Blue Converts tungsten to daylight - 3200K to 3600K. 69.20
  204 Full CT Orange Converts daylight to tungsten light - 6500K to 3200K. 55.40
  205 1/2 CT Orange Converts daylight to tungsten light - 6500K to 3800K. 70.80
  206 1/4 CT Orange Converts daylight to tungsten light - 6500K to 4600K. 79.10
  207 CT Orange + 0.3 ND Converts daylight to tungsten 6500K to 3200K and reduces light 1 stop. 32.50
  208 CT Orange + 0.6 ND Converts daylight to tungsten 6500K to 3200K and reduces light 2 stops. 15.60
  209 0.3 Neutral Density Reduces light 1 stop, without changing colour. 51.20
  210 0.6 Neutral Density Reduces light 2 stops, without changing colour. 23.50
  211 0.9 Neutral Density Reduces light 3 stops, without changing colour. 13.70
  212 L.C.T. Yellow Reduces colour temperature of low carbon arcs to 3200K. 88.70
  213 White Flame Green Corrects white flame carbon arcs by absorbing ultra violet. 80.00

  236 H.M.I. (To Tungsten) Converts HMI to 3200K, for use with Tungsten film. 58.20
  241 Fluorescent 5700K Converts tungsten to fluorescent light of 5700K (white). 32.00
  242 Fluorescent 4300K Converts tungsten to fluorescent light of 4300K (white). 37.30
  243 Fluorescent 3600K Converts tungsten to fluorescent light of 3600K (warm white). 45.70
  244 Plus Green Adds green when balancing to fluorescent and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C30 green camera filter. 74.20
  245 1/2 Plus Green Adds green when balancing to fluorescent and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C15 green camera filter 81.70
  246 1/4 Plus Green Adds green when balancing to fluorescent and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C075 green camera filter. 84.60
  247 Minus Green Reduces green from fluorescents and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C30 magenta camera filter. 59.10
  248 1/2 Minus Green Reduces green from fluorescents and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C15 magenta camera filter. 72.00
  249 1/4 Minus Green Reduces green from fluorescents and other discharge sources. Approximately equivalent to CC75 magenta camera filter 82.40
